The Elden Ring Board Game is Coming Your Way

One of the greatest games of all time is getting its own board game adaption. Soon players will be able to explore the Lands Between on the top of your table thanks to Steamforged Games. The popular board game maker, who is responsible for the likes of Dark Souls, Horizon Zero Dawn and the Resident Evil board games has announced the Elden Ring board game through Kickstarter.

Little is known about the Elden Ring board game at this time. The game’s official description says it will see one to four players embark on a huge and varied adventure, visiting iconic locations and crossing paths with familiar enemies and characters.

In a vast, sprawling world of decaying grandeur that unfolds through your exploration, you’ll embark on a huge and varied adventure, visiting iconic locations and crossing paths with familiar enemies and characters. Play solo, or with up to three other Tarnished.

The game aims to recreate the video game’s iconic battles with all creatures including the bosses and enemies by using an intelligent dice-free approach. Players are required to strategise and adapt their plans during each encounter whether that be a lowly Godrick Soldier or the Grafted King himself.

Mat Hart, Co-Founder and Chief Creative Officer at Steamforged Games said:

“ELDEN RING™ is a stunning, genre-defining video game, and we are humbled and privileged to be bringing it to your tabletops. To say our team is passionate about the game would be an understatement.

“Our mission is always to deliver authentic tabletop adaptations that capture the essence of what fans know and love about the IP. Fans should expect a dark, richly-realised tabletop world of mystery and peril, with satisfying combat and rewarding exploration. Prepare to lose hours to this game, and to be glad about it.” 

At the moment we don’t have a release date for this Elden Ring board game. The only image we have is one 3D printed Margit, The Fell Omen boss figurine (pictured above).
